96. Al - Baqi



Allah is everlasting, Allah is Al-Baqi.

Indeed, we have believed in our Lord that He may forgive us our sins and what you compelled us [to do] of magic. And Allah is better and more enduring.“ 20:73

As humans, the concept of infinity and everlasting, although we know its meaning, cannot be fully understood because everything on this earth has its appointed time. On that day that the horn will blow, everyone will pass away but Allah will remain. Allah will never come to an end as he has no beginning. Time is of no relevance to Allah, Allah created time. All of creation is brought to life, lives and dies. Anything that has been created will come to an end, except for the one who created all of creation, Allah, Al-Baqi.

This name is hard to elaborate on because our minds cannot go past what we know and there is nothing that we know equivalent to Allah. We have understanding of the created but Allah is not created, he is the creator.

The Everlasting, The Eternal, The Ever-Enduring, The Ever-Present

The One who has always existed and who will never cease to be. The One whose existence has neither beginning nor end. The One whose existence is beyond the realm of time.

The One who existed before all of creation, and who will remain after all of this creation has come and gone.

The One who is everlasting, perpetual, beginning-less, endless. The One whose existence is eternal. The One who remains forever, unaffected by time.

From the root b-q-y which has the following classical Arabic connotations:
to remain, continue, endure
to be permanent, everlasting, constant
to survive forever
to be incessant, continuous, endless

The term Bāqī is not specifically used as a Beautiful Name in the Qur'ān.

The term Abqā, also from the b-q-y root, is used in the Qur'ān (20:73) where it is commonly translated as the Most Lasting, Ever Lasting or Most Abiding.

The term baqiyyah is used in the Qur'ān (11:116) to describe persons of excellence, those who possess spiritual understanding and inner discrimination, those who possess a quality of attending to that which is eternal.
